The Heart of a Preschool Graduation Message From Teacher
A Preschool Graduation Message From Teacher is more than just a few words; it's a reflection of the bond formed over months of learning, playing, and discovery. It's an opportunity to highlight the unique spark each child possesses and to express pride in their accomplishments, big or small. These messages serve as a tangible reminder of their preschool experience and the role you played in it.
The importance of a thoughtful and personalized Preschool Graduation Message From Teacher cannot be overstated. It reinforces a child's sense of accomplishment and self-worth. For many preschoolers, this is their first formal recognition of success, and your words can significantly impact their confidence as they move on to kindergarten and beyond. These messages can also provide comfort and excitement for the transition ahead.
- It celebrates academic milestones like learning letters and numbers.
- It acknowledges social-emotional growth, such as sharing and making friends.
- It recognizes their creativity and imagination through art and play.
- It fosters a positive association with learning and school.
Consider these elements when crafting your message:
- Specific memories you share.
- Words of encouragement for the future.
- Praise for their effort and participation.
Here’s a quick look at what makes a great message:
| What to Include | Why it Matters |
|---|---|
| Positive Affirmations | Builds confidence and self-esteem. |
| Future Encouragement | Prepares them for new adventures. |
| Personal Anecdotes | Makes the message unique and memorable. |

Preschool Graduation Message From Teacher for Celebrating Effort and Progress
- "Wow, look how much you've grown! Your effort this year has been truly wonderful."
- "You worked so hard to learn your letters/numbers/sharing. I'm so impressed!"
- "Every day you came to school with a smile and a willingness to try your best. That's what matters most!"
- "Remember when you first started? You’ve made such amazing progress. You should be so proud!"
- "Your dedication to learning is inspiring. Keep that fantastic effort going!"
- "I saw you helping your friends and trying new things, even when it was a little scary. That shows real bravery!"
- "You never gave up, even on the trickiest tasks. That resilience will serve you well."
- "Your progress this year has been remarkable. You’ve blossomed like a beautiful flower!"
- "It’s been a joy watching you tackle challenges and learn from them. Keep up the great work!"
- "Your hard work and enthusiasm made our classroom a special place. Thank you!"

Preschool Graduation Message From Teacher for Recalling Fun Memories
- "I'll always remember our fun times during [mention an activity, e.g., story time, playground adventures]."
- "Who could forget when we [mention a funny or memorable event, e.g., all giggled at the silly song]?"
- "It was so much fun watching you [mention something they enjoyed doing, e.g., build tall towers, paint colorful pictures]."
- "Your enthusiasm during our [mention a theme or project, e.g., space week, bug investigation] was infectious!"
- "I loved seeing your face light up when we [mention a special activity, e.g., read your favorite book, sang our goodbye song]."
- "The laughter we shared during [mention a specific game or song] will always bring a smile to my face."
- "Remember our exciting [mention an outing or event, e.g., field trip to the park]? That was such a happy day!"
- "Your participation in our [mention a classroom event, e.g., show and tell, dramatic play] always brought so much joy."
- "I'll cherish the memories of you [mention a kind action, e.g., sharing your toys, helping a friend]."
- "Thank you for filling our classroom with so much fun and wonder this year!"
